How Do I Repair A Sagging Gutter?

Sagging gutters are not just an eyesore but can also lead to significant water damage if left unrepaired. The process of repairing a sagging gutter begins with a thorough inspection to identify the root cause of the problem. This inspection should cover the entire length of the gutter, focusing on areas of visible sagging, as well as the condition of hangers and brackets. It is crucial to diagnose the issue accurately to ensure that the repair strategy is effective and long-lasting.

Once the cause of the sagging has been identified, the next step involves repairing or replacing any damaged components. This may include fixing or replacing broken hangers, brackets, or sections of the gutter itself. It is important to use materials that match the existing gutter system in size and type, ensuring a seamless repair. Additionally, reinforcing the gutter system with extra hangers or stronger brackets might be necessary to provide additional support and prevent future sagging.

The final step in repairing a sagging gutter is to adjust its slope and secure it firmly. A properly sloped gutter ensures efficient water flow and reduces the likelihood of sagging and blockages. The slope should ideally be about 1/4 inch for every 10 feet of gutter length. After adjusting the slope, securing the gutter in place is essential to ensure stability and functionality. Regular maintenance and inspections can further help in preventing sagging and extending the life of your gutter system.


What Causes Gutters to Sag?

Gutters can sag due to various reasons, ranging from poor installation to environmental factors. Understanding these causes is crucial in preventing future issues. One of the primary reasons for gutter sagging is improper installation, where the gutter system lacks sufficient support or is not correctly aligned. This can lead to an uneven distribution of weight, causing the gutter to sag over time.

Another common cause of gutter sagging is the weight of debris, such as leaves, twigs, and standing water. Over time, this accumulated weight can strain the gutter system, especially if not cleaned regularly. Additionally, the material of the gutter itself can play a role in sagging. For instance, plastic gutters are more prone to bending and sagging compared to their metal counterparts, especially under heavy loads or extreme temperatures.

Identifying Common Signs of Gutter Damage

To effectively repair a sagging gutter, it is essential to recognize the signs of gutter damage early on. Visible sagging is the most obvious indicator, where the gutter dips or bends away from its intended position. Another sign to look out for is the separation of the gutter from the fascia board, indicating that the hangers or brackets are failing.

Water damage or staining on the siding or foundation of your house can also suggest gutter problems. This is often a result of water spilling over due to blockages or an improperly sloped gutter. Additionally, rust, cracks, or holes in the gutter are clear signs of deterioration that can lead to sagging if not addressed in a timely manner.

The Impact of Weather and Age on Gutters

Weather conditions and the age of the gutters significantly influence their integrity and performance. Extreme weather events, such as heavy snowfall, ice, or strong winds, can exert additional pressure on gutters, leading to sagging or detachment. Over time, exposure to harsh weather elements can weaken the gutter material, making it more susceptible to damage.

Aging is another critical factor affecting gutter performance. As gutters age, they may become brittle, especially in the case of plastic or vinyl gutters. Metal gutters, while more durable, are not immune to the effects of time and can corrode or rust, compromising their strength. Regular inspections and maintenance can mitigate these issues, ensuring that your gutters remain functional and reliable for years to come.

Step-by-Step Guide to Gutter Inspection

A systematic approach to gutter inspection ensures that you don’t miss any potential issues. Begin at one end of the gutter and work your way to the other end. Check for debris, such as leaves and twigs, that might be causing blockages. Inspect the condition of the gutter material for any signs of rust, cracks, or holes. Pay special attention to the seams and joints, as these are common areas for leaks to develop. Also, examine the gutter hangers and brackets; they should be firmly attached to the fascia and not loose or missing. Lastly, assess the gutter’s slope to ensure it is angled correctly for optimal water flow.

Tools and Safety Tips for Gutter Inspection

Safety should be your top priority when inspecting gutters. Use a sturdy, extendable ladder and ensure it is securely placed on a stable, level surface. Consider using a ladder stabilizer for added safety. Wear gloves to protect your hands from sharp edges and debris, and use safety goggles to shield your eyes. Essential tools for the inspection include a garden trowel or gutter scoop for removing debris, a bucket to collect the debris, and a hose to flush the gutters and downspouts to check for proper water flow and leaks.

Replacing Cracked Gutters and Broken Hangers

When replacing cracked gutters or broken hangers, it’s important to choose the right replacement parts that match your existing gutter system. If a section of the gutter is cracked, remove it by detaching the surrounding hangers and carefully sliding out the damaged piece. Replace it with a new section of the same material and size, ensuring a snug fit. For broken hangers, remove the old ones and replace them with new, more robust hangers. This may require new holes to be drilled into the fascia board. Secure the new hangers firmly to provide adequate support for the gutters.

Selecting the Right Materials for Gutter Repair

Choosing the correct materials for gutter repair is crucial for longevity and performance. Match the material (aluminum, vinyl, steel, etc.) and size of the existing gutter to ensure compatibility and effectiveness. When replacing hangers or screws, opt for rust-resistant materials like stainless steel or aluminum, especially in areas with high humidity or rainfall. If sealing joints or cracks, use a high-quality, waterproof sealant designed for gutter systems. For areas with heavy snowfall or rainfall, consider upgrading to stronger materials or larger gutters to handle the increased load.

Reinforcing Gutter Hangers and Brackets

One effective way to prevent gutter sagging is to reinforce the gutter hangers and brackets. Over time, hangers can weaken or become loose, compromising the structural integrity of the gutter system. To reinforce them, add extra hangers or replace the old ones with more robust models. The hangers should be spaced appropriately, typically every two to three feet, to provide adequate support. Additionally, ensure that the brackets are securely attached to the fascia board. If the fascia wood is rotten or damaged, it should be repaired or replaced to provide a solid anchor for the hangers.

Adjusting and Securing the Gutter Slope

Correct gutter slope is essential for efficient water flow and prevention of sagging. Gutters should have a slight slope towards the downspouts, approximately 1/4 inch for every 10 feet of gutter. Over time, this slope can become misaligned due to various factors such as improper installation or settling of the house. Adjusting the slope involves repositioning the gutters and ensuring they are secured at the correct angle. Regular checks and adjustments to the slope are necessary to ensure that water is efficiently channeled away, reducing the risk of water accumulation and the weight burden on the gutters.
